Berghoff Restaurant Creamed Spinach

From the Berghoff Family Cookbook. This recipe was secret until after the restaurant closed in 2006. It was the only dish in the restaurant that was not made completely from scratch--they always used frozen spinach. Show more

Directions

  1. Place half-and-half, milk, chicken base, Tabasco sauce, nutmeg, garlic, and celery salt in a medium saucepan and heat just until simmering.
  2. Remove from heat, but keep warm.
  3. In a separate medium saucepan, heat butter over medium heat.
  4. Whisk in flour.
  5. Cook for 2-3 minutes, stirring often.
  6. Slowly whisk warm milk mixture into butter mixture a little at a time, whisking constantly.
  7. Simmer for 5 minutes, stirring constantly, until very thick.
  8. Stir in spinach and simmer for 5 minutes.
  9. Season with salt and ground white pepper if desired.
  10. Garnish with bacon and additional nutmeg, if desired.
